Transaction 2f6b251feb2827e0f3fa5f9430a0dabf3544a7fd8c404432c08a615becb49d44
1 Input
1 Outputs
- 2f6b251feb2827e0f3fa5f9430a0dabf3544a7fd8c404432c08a615becb49d44:0
value 9333407
address 35JdTpfdot7q4LJt66NaNLGAWUEiXG75vE